What Is Billboard Advertising?
Billboard advertising is a form of outdoor advertising that uses large displays placed along roads, highways, and busy urban areas.
These advertisements are designed to attract attention from drivers and pedestrians.
Billboards are commonly placed in high traffic locations so they can reach thousands of viewers each day.
Advertisers use billboards to promote products, services, events, or brand awareness.

What Is Online Advertising?
Online advertising refers to promotional messages delivered through the internet.
These advertisements appear on platforms such as:
Search engines
Websites
Social media platforms
Mobile applications
Online advertising allows businesses to reach audiences using digital devices such as smartphones, tablets, and computers.
Many online campaigns focus on targeting specific audiences based on demographics, interests, and browsing behavior.

Targeting Capabilities
Online advertising offers advanced audience targeting tools.
Advertisers can target users based on:
Location
Age
Interests
Online behavior
Billboard advertising relies more on geographic targeting.
Advertisers place billboards in locations where their target audience is likely to travel.
For example, a restaurant may place advertisements near shopping districts or busy streets.
Location strategy plays an important role in outdoor advertising success.
Visibility and Attention
Billboards provide constant visibility.
Drivers and pedestrians cannot skip or block billboard advertisements. This makes them effective for brand awareness.
However, viewers only have a few seconds to read the message.

Cost Comparison
Advertising costs vary depending on the campaign size and platform.
Billboard advertising costs depend on factors such as:
Location
Traffic volume
Billboard type
Premium locations often have higher prices.

Online advertising often uses pricing models such as:
Cost per click
Cost per impression
Cost per conversion
These models allow advertisers to control budgets and track performance more precisely.
Measuring Advertising Performance
Online advertising provides detailed performance data.
Advertisers can measure metrics such as:
Clicks
Conversions
Engagement rates
Billboard advertising performance is usually measured through visibility estimates and audience reach.
Businesses often track campaign success using brand awareness studies or traffic data.
